I guess that's because 100 Mbit/s works out to basically 32 TB per month, but the port speeds are faster than 100 Mbit/s for all plans (or at least that's what their website says) - so you could theoretically push a constant 200 Mbit/s and hit the bandwidth cap after (roughly) 15 days.

Disk IO is limited too 100MB/s until you contact support, probably because of abusers ¯_(ツ)_/¯. Just make a ticket and tell them about the IO speeds and they should later be at normal SATA SSD speeds.

They have been reply the email:
Dear Lam,
Thank you very much for your e-mail.
Our VPS infrastructure is built for optimal overall performance for all customers. Our benchmarks have shown that with our current default settings, latency is low and IOPS are at a maximum. These two factors are crucial for fast reaction times and high processing speed of typical server applications such as databases.
We have adjusted the parameters of your VPS so that significantly higher sequential write throughput can now be achieved as well. The change is effective immediately.
